'Zimbra quota message text style
currently I have a problem connected with Zimbra WebMail. I want to format quota warning in such way that a part of it would be in bold text. Sadly I can't find anwser online about such text formatting/styling.
My template message in Advanced settings of mailbox type looks like that
From: Postmaster <postmaster@${RECIPIENT_DOMAIN}>${NEWLINE}To: ${RECIPIENT_NAME} <${RECIPIENT_ADDRESS}>${NEWLINE}Subject: Quota warning${NEWLINE}Date: ${DATE}${NEWLINE}Content-Type: text/plain${NEWLINE}${NEWLINE}Your mailbox size has reached ${MBOX_SIZE_MB}MB, which is over ${WARN_PERCENT}% of your ${QUOTA_MB}MB quota.${NEWLINE}Please delete some messages to avoid exceeding your quota.${NEWLINE}There is also possibility to increase your quota.${NEWLINE}If the mailbox is full, you will not be able to sent or receive messages.
And I would like to make "which is over ${WARN_PERCENT}%" in bold or/and red text. I have tried to edit text/plain to say text/bold but sadly it doesn't work like that.
Is it even possible to change style of quota message in that way, or is it always plain text?
